meet our newest addition - lady grey. this lot comes from 33 smallholder farms in okoluu, guji. the cherries consist of mixed heirloom varieties and are dried natural, creating a sweet, floral and complex coffee with notes of earl grey, honeycomb and milk chocolate. this lot grows on an altitude between 2000-2150 meters and is harvested entirely by hand, with farmers selectively picking only ripe coffee cherries. after harvest, the cherries are spread out to dry on raised beds, where they are regularly turned to ensure even drying. the drying process takes approximately two to three weeks. origin: ethiopia region: okoluu, oddo shakiso, guji cooperation: okoluu farmers: 33 smallholder farms processing: natural variety: mixed heirloom altitude: 2000 - 2150 m notes: earl grey, honeycomb, milk chocolate suitable for: filter & espresso partner: sucafina
